svn commit: r1054573 - /ofbiz/trunk/framework/widget/src/org/ofbiz/widget/form/UtilHelpText.java

Previous Topic Next Topic
 
classic Classic list List threaded Threaded
1 message Options
Reply | Threaded
Open this post in threaded view
|

svn commit: r1054573 - /ofbiz/trunk/framework/widget/src/org/ofbiz/widget/form/UtilHelpText.java

erwan
Author: erwan
Date: Mon Jan  3 10:17:39 2011
New Revision: 1054573

URL: http://svn.apache.org/viewvc?rev=1054573&view=rev
Log:
Online documentation wasn't working as described in ExampleEntityLabels :
        FieldDescription.[fieldname] - will be used for all fields of that name
        FieldDescription.[entityname].[fieldname] - will be used for the specified entity field

The FieldDescription.[fieldname] wasn't supported yet, now it's done. I've also changed the log level to verbose as it may full the log console it there are a lot of fields on a screen

Modified:
    ofbiz/trunk/framework/widget/src/org/ofbiz/widget/form/UtilHelpText.java

Modified: ofbiz/trunk/framework/widget/src/org/ofbiz/widget/form/UtilHelpText.java
URL: http://svn.apache.org/viewvc/ofbiz/trunk/framework/widget/src/org/ofbiz/widget/form/UtilHelpText.java?rev=1054573&r1=1054572&r2=1054573&view=diff
==============================================================================
--- ofbiz/trunk/framework/widget/src/org/ofbiz/widget/form/UtilHelpText.java (original)
+++ ofbiz/trunk/framework/widget/src/org/ofbiz/widget/form/UtilHelpText.java Mon Jan  3 10:17:39 2011
@@ -52,10 +52,17 @@ public class UtilHelpText {
         String messageId = "FieldDescription." + entityName + "." + fieldName;
         String fieldDescription = UtilProperties.getMessage(entityResourceName, messageId, locale);
         if (fieldDescription.equals(messageId)) {
-            if (Debug.infoOn()) {
-                Debug.logInfo("No help text found in [" + entityResourceName + "] with key [" + messageId + "]", module);
+            messageId = "FieldDescription." + fieldName;
+            if (Debug.verboseOn()) {
+                Debug.logVerbose("No help text found in [" + entityResourceName + "] with key [" + messageId + "], Trying with: " + messageId, module);
+            }
+            fieldDescription = UtilProperties.getMessage(entityResourceName, messageId, locale);
+            if (fieldDescription.equals(messageId)) {
+                if (Debug.verboseOn()) {
+                    Debug.logVerbose("No help text found in [" + entityResourceName + "] with key [" + messageId + "]", module);
+                }
+                return "";
             }
-            return "";
         }
         return fieldDescription;
     }